Hello friends! I’ve been craving Neapolitan pizza so Grayson and I finally went back to Famoso pizzeria and bar! We haven’t been here in a few years so we didn’t even know they had a Famoso pizzeria and bar Surrey location! What I like about Famoso pizzeria and bar Surrey is that they had a $5 daily special menu! How could anyone resist?

Linguine rose with prawns

We started with a half size of the Linguine rose with prawns. It came with prawns, rose sauce, Grana Padano cheese and a slice of garlic bread. A “slice” of garlic bread was an understatement because it was such a huge piece! I felt like I had 1/4 of a baguette on the plate! The rose sauce was your typical garlicy tomato sauce with a dash of cream. I didn’t think it was anything spectacular but there was a generous amount of sauce so that every noodle was covered. The prawns were cooked well and didn’t come in the shell which made it easy to eat.

Abruzzo pizza

Grayson wanted to try their new Abruzzo pizza ($18) so that’s what we decided to go with. It had oven roasted sausage, spicy soppressata (pepperoni), mushrooms, and smoked mozzarella. The menu said that it was also supposed to have red onions and fennel seeds but we didn’t get a lot of it on the pizza because we hardly noticed that it had any at all.

The pizza had a thin crust but it wasn’t very crisp. Especially towards the middle where there were more sauces and toppings. The sausage and pepperoni added a light spice to the pizza with the tomato sauce and cheese mellowing everything out. The pizza was cut into 6 large slices that quickly filled us up.
